The impact of online piracy is not limited to the entertainment industry. Online piracy also poses a significant threat to the economy, as it can lead to job losses, reduced investment in new content, and decreased tax revenues. Furthermore, online piracy can also compromise user security, as many pirate websites and streaming platforms are known to distribute malware and other types of cyber threats.

The impact of online piracy is significant, and it affects not just the creators and owners of content, but also the broader economy. According to a report by the International Federation of the Phonographic Industry (IFPI), online piracy costs the music industry alone over $30 billion annually. Similarly, a report by the Motion Picture Association of America (MPAA) estimated that online piracy costs the film industry over $40 billion annually.
